Shannon Elizabeth unveiled as the first Bond Game Girl! The `American Pie` star secures a role in `Everything or Nothing`

16-May-2003 • Gaming

Electronic Arts announced today that film actress Shannon Elizabeth (famous for her role in "American Pie") has joined the ranks of Hollywood talent enlisted by EA and will lend her talents to the next James Bond game "Everything or Nothing".

Elizabeth will provide her likeness and voice for the first original interactive Bond girl to be cast, "Serena St. Germaine". Her character will be an integral part of the original storyline in this new installment.

"As an avid gamer, I am so excited to be a part of the James Bond 007: Everything or Nothing videogame. I`ve always wanted to be part of the Bond franchise, and working in interactive entertainment gives me another medium to express myself," said Ms. Elizabeth.



In the game, EA claim players will answer the question: "What would James Bond do?" as they encounter classic villains, exotic locations, beautiful girls, fast cars, and high-tech gadgetry. The original storyline immerses the player in the world of James Bond with missions that span exotic locales in four continents, all set in a third person view that showcases the Hollywood cast playing out a real-time cinematic action adventure. Other new features will include two-player co-op missions and four-player multiplayer arena modes, both featuring third person views and multiple playable characters.
